Nylon Cable Gland for Marine Use: A Comprehensive Guide

  Nylon cable glands are essential components in the marine industry, providing a reliable and durable solution for protecting electrical connections in harsh environments. This article aims to provide a comprehensive guide to nylon cable glands for marine use, covering their features, benefits, and applications.

  **Introduction**

  Marine environments are notorious for their challenging conditions, including saltwater corrosion, extreme temperatures, and high humidity. These conditions can be detrimental to electrical connections, leading to malfunctions and safety hazards. Nylon cable glands offer a robust solution to protect these connections, ensuring the longevity and reliability of marine equipment.

  **What is a Nylon Cable Gland?**

  A nylon cable gland is a type of cable connector used to secure and protect electrical cables in industrial and marine environments. It is designed to provide a watertight seal, preventing water, dust, and other contaminants from entering the cable connection. The gland is typically made of nylon, a durable and flexible material that can withstand harsh conditions.

  **Features of Nylon Cable Glands for Marine Use**

  1. **Material**: Nylon cable glands are made from high-quality nylon materials, offering excellent resistance to corrosion, UV radiation, and chemicals commonly found in marine environments.
2. **Design**: These glands are designed with a compression mechanism that ensures a secure and watertight seal, even under extreme pressure and vibration.
3. **Installation**: They are easy to install and can be used with a variety of cable types and sizes.
4. **Customization**: Available in various sizes, shapes, and thread types, nylon cable glands can be customized to meet specific application requirements.

  **Benefits of Using Nylon Cable Glands in Marine Applications**

  1. **Protection**: The primary benefit of using nylon cable glands in marine applications is the protection they offer to electrical connections. They prevent water, dust, and other contaminants from entering the cable, reducing the risk of malfunctions and electrical hazards.
2. **Durability**: Nylon cable glands are highly durable and can withstand the harsh conditions of marine environments, including saltwater corrosion, extreme temperatures, and high humidity.
3. **Reliability**: The compression mechanism of nylon cable glands ensures a secure and watertight seal, providing reliable protection for electrical connections.
4. **Cost-Effective**: These glands are cost-effective, offering a long-lasting solution for protecting electrical connections in marine applications.

  **Applications of Nylon Cable Glands in Marine Environments**

  1. **Shipbuilding**: Nylon cable glands are widely used in shipbuilding for protecting electrical connections in engine rooms, navigation systems, and other critical areas.
2. **Offshore Platforms**: They are essential for protecting electrical connections in offshore platforms, ensuring the safety and reliability of equipment in harsh marine environments.
3. **Marine Equipment**: Nylon cable glands are used in various marine equipment, such as lifeboats, cranes, and winches, to protect electrical connections from damage.
